View Product Featured Lapidary Tools Diamond Grinding Wheel Durable wheels for shaping and smoothing stones Flat Lap Disc Precision grinding for flat surfaces Polishing Pads Mirror finishing for gemstones and glass View Product Related Tools • Diamond Grinding Tools • Flat Laps & Discs • Cabbing Machines • Flexible Diamond Abrasives Frequently Asked Questions How do I choose the right lapidary grinding wheel? Choose based on grit and material hardness. Coarse for shaping, fine for polishing. What grit is best for polishing gemstones? Start with 220–400, then 600–1200, finish with 3000+ grit. Can these tools be used on glass? Yes, most diamond tools are suitable for glass and gemstones.

Home / Diamond Wire Saw / Cut Ceramic / Ceramic Cut with Diamond Wire Loop Precision diamond wire saws are essential tools for cutting and shaping hard materials like ceramics. The use of ceramic cutting diamond wire loop saws has become increasingly popular due to their ability to provide precise cuts with minimal damage to the material. Continuous diamond wire, such as the 0.7mm OD diamond wire loop, is ideal for cutting ceramics. With a cutting speed of 40-70m/s and a feed speed of 30-70mm/min, this diamond wire loop saw can achieve a Ra of up to 0.5-0.7 μm. This level of precision is critical in many applications where the surface finish of the ceramic is critical. The life of the diamond wire loop saw is also an important consideration. With a lifespan of 1.6-2.1㎡, this diamond wire loop saw can handle many cutting applications before needing to be replaced. They are essential tools in industries where precision cutting is crucial for achieving high-quality end products. Feature The diamond wire loop is the cutting tool in this setup. It consists of a wire with diamond particles embedded in it. The specification for the diamond wire loop includes: Diameter: Typically, diamond wire loops have diameters ranging from 100 to 300 micrometers (μm), but it can vary depending on the specific application. Diamond Grit Size: The size of the diamond particles embedded in the wire, specified in mesh or micrometers.0.35-2.5mm Wire Length: The length of the diamond wire loop needed for the particular cutting application.100mm-10000mm Tensioning System: To maintain the proper tension in the wire loop, you need a tensioning system that can be adjusted to the required tension. This helps ensure the wire loop remains stable during cutting.100N-300N Feed Mechanism: A feed mechanism is used to control the rate at which the wire loop moves through the ceramic material. It should be adjustable to accommodate various cutting speeds. Coolant System: Cutting ceramics generates heat, so a coolant system is essential to prevent overheating and maintain the integrity of the diamond wire loop. Water or specialized cutting fluids are commonly used as coolants. Workholding and Fixturing: The ceramic material being cut must be securely held in place to ensure precision and safety during the cutting process. The type of workholding or fixturing system used depends on the shape and size of the ceramic workpiece. Control System: A control system is required to manage the feed rate, tension, and other parameters of the cutting process. It may involve computer numerical control (CNC) or manual control, depending on the level of automation. Safety Features: Safety is paramount when working with diamond wire cutting systems. Emergency stop buttons, safety interlocks, and protective enclosures are often incorporated into the setup to protect operators. Monitoring and Measurement: To ensure accuracy, it's important to have monitoring and measurement systems in place. These may include sensors to measure wire tension, temperature, and other relevant parameters. Environmental Considerations: Diamond wire cutting can generate dust and waste materials. Adequate dust extraction and disposal systems should be part of the setup to maintain a clean and safe working environment. Maintenance and Consumables: Regular maintenance is necessary to keep the diamond wire loop in optimal condition. Replacement diamond wire loops and other consumables should be readily available. Power Supply: Ensure a stable power supply to run the cutting machine, as voltage fluctuations can affect the cutting precision. User Manuals and Training: Proper training and user manuals should be provided to operators to ensure safe and efficient operation. Application Diamond Wire Loops are commonly used in cutting ceramic materials due to their precision and efficiency. The application of Diamond Wire Loop cutting in ceramics includes: Tile Production: Diamond Wire Loops are used to cut ceramic tiles with precision, ensuring uniform sizes and smooth edges. This is crucial in the tile manufacturing industry to produce high-quality, aesthetically pleasing tiles. Ceramic Wafers: In the electronics industry, ceramics are used to make substrates and wafers for various applications. Diamond Wire Loop cutting is employed to cut and shape these ceramic wafers, ensuring accurate dimensions. Ceramic Pipes and Tubes: Diamond Wire Loops are used to cut ceramic pipes and tubes for applications such as plumbing, industrial machinery, and laboratory equipment. Precise cuts are essential to ensure proper fit and functionality. Ceramic Components for Electronics: Ceramics are used in electronic components such as insulators, capacitors, and resistors. Diamond Wire Loop cutting ensures precise shaping of these components for optimal performance. Ceramic Art and Sculpture: Artists and sculptors use Diamond Wire Loop cutting to shape and sculpt ceramic materials, allowing for intricate and detailed designs. Ceramic Bearings and Insulators: In industries like aerospace and automotive, ceramic bearings and insulators are used for their high-temperature resistance and durability. Diamond Wire Loop cutting helps in shaping and finishing these components. Advanced Ceramics: Diamond Wire Loops are employed in cutting advanced ceramics used in aerospace, defense, and medical applications due to their exceptional hardness and wear resistance. Ceramic Laboratory Equipment: Laboratories use ceramics for various equipment, such as crucibles and vessels. Diamond Wire Loop cutting ensures precise manufacturing of these laboratory ceramics. Ceramic Grinding Wheels: In the manufacturing of ceramic grinding wheels used for precision grinding, Diamond Wire Loop cutting is used to shape and size the wheels accurately. Ceramic Insulation Materials: In the construction and industrial sectors, ceramic materials are used for insulation. Diamond Wire Loop cutting helps cut and shape these materials for installation. Diamond Wire Loop cutting is favored for ceramics due to its ability to achieve clean, precise cuts with minimal material loss and excellent surface finishes. It is essential in industries where ceramic materials are used for their unique properties and where precision is critical for the performance and quality of the end products. Home / CBN Wheel Sharpening / CBN Diamond Wheel for Knife Sharpening CBN Grinding wheels are an excellent choice for sharpening woodturning tools and knives. They are versatile and can be used for saw grinding, edge grinding, and surface grinding. These wheels can be manufactured with diamond powder, CBN powder, or a combination of both. The CBN Wheel for Knife Sharpening is perfect for tool and cutter grinding, off-hand grinding, face grinding, and top grinding. The diamond sharpening wheel can feature phenol, polyimide, hybrid, or electro-chemical bonds. The sizes range from 2” – 16” in diameter. These wheels are factory balanced, which makes grinders run very smoothly. The grinding wheels have a 1 1/2" face to use, and they don't need any dressing, which means you won't have the mess of truing wheels or breathing the dust related to dressing wheels. One of the best things about CBN grinding wheels is that there is no bluing of the steel. These grinding wheels put very little heat into the tool, so in a normal sharpening, you can still touch the end of the tool. The guards can be removed with these wheels because there is no chance of them blowing up. The precision wheel features a seamless all-steel wheel with a smooth uniform coating of 600 mesh diamond. The radiused surface fits conventional and hawkbill style blades, making it perfect for Mexican and Filipino style knives. It can be used wet or dry. Grit Range CBN (Cubic Boron Nitride) diamond sharpening wheels come in various grit ranges to accommodate different sharpening needs and applications. The choice of grit size depends on the type of cutting tool or material you are sharpening and the desired level of sharpness or finish.General overview of common CBN sharpening wheel grit ranges: Coarse Grit (80 to 180): Coarse-grit CBN wheels are used for rapid material removal and reprofiling of tools. Suitable for sharpening heavily damaged or dull tools. Commonly used for shaping and rough sharpening. Medium Grit (220 to 400): Medium-grit CBN wheels provide a balance between material removal and sharpening precision. Ideal for general-purpose sharpening of tools, including turning tools, chisels, and drill bits. Suitable for restoring the cutting edge on moderately worn tools. Fine Grit (600 to 1,000): Fine-grit CBN wheels are used for achieving a sharp cutting edge with a smooth finish. Suitable for sharpening and honing woodworking tools, lathe tools, and carving tools. Ideal for maintaining the sharpness of tools without significant material removal. Extra Fine Grit (1,200 and above): Extra fine-grit CBN wheels are used for achieving an extremely sharp and polished edge. Commonly used for honing and polishing fine woodworking tools, knives, and blades. Ideal for achieving a mirror-like finish on the cutting edge. Application Lapidary trim Saw s are versatile tools used in the field of lapidary and jewelry making for a variety of cutting applications. Here are some common applications for lapidary trim Saw s: Gemstone Cutting : Lapidary trim Saws are commonly used to cut raw gemstone material into smaller, workable pieces. This is the initial step in the gemstone faceting process. Cabochon Preparation: Cabochons are polished, rounded gemstone shapes used in jewelry. Trim Saws are used to cut rough gemstone material into cabochon blanks before further shaping and polishing. Specimen Preparation: Lapidary enthusiasts and rockhounds use trim Saws to prepare mineral and rock specimens for display or study. The Saws allow for controlled cutting of larger specimens into manageable sizes. Lapidary Artistry: Artists and craftspeople use trim Saws to create intricate designs and patterns in gemstones, minerals, and lapidary materials. The saws enable precise and detailed cutting for artistic purposes. Repair and Reshaping: Lapidarists use trim Saws to repair damaged gemstones or reshape existing cabochons and faceted stones to improve their appearance or fit specific jewelry settings. Inlay Work: Trim Saws are employed to cut small, precise pieces of gemstone or material for inlay work in jewelry and woodworking projects. Custom Jewelry Making: Jewelers use lapidary trim Saws to custom-cut gemstones for unique jewelry designs, ensuring that the stones fit specific settings and designs. Fossil Preparation: Paleontologists and fossil enthusiasts use trim Saws to cut and prepare fossil specimens for scientific study or display. Tumbling Material: Lapidary enthusiasts often use trim Saws to cut rough material into smaller pieces suitable for tumbling to create polished stones. Material Testing: In geological and material science research, trim Saws are used to obtain thin sections of rocks and minerals for microscopic analysis. Education and Workshops: Lapidary trim Saws are used in lapidary workshops and educational settings to teach cutting and shaping techniques to students and hobbyists. Repair and Restoration: In the field of antique restoration, lapidary trim Saws are employed to replace missing or damaged gemstones in vintage jewelry and decorative objects. Lapidary slab Saws are specialized cutting tools used in the lapidary and geological fields for cutting and shaping larger rock specimens and slabs. Here are some common applications for lapidary slab Saws : Large Specimen Cutting : Lapidary slab Saws are primarily used to cut large rock specimens and mineral samples into smaller, more manageable pieces. This is especially useful when working with larger geological samples or rough materials. Slabbing Rough: Lapidarists use slab Saws to turn rough, uncut rock material into flat slabs that can be further processed and shaped into cabochons, spheres, or other lapidary forms. Mineral and Fossil Preparation: Geologists and paleontologists use slab Saws to prepare mineral and fossil specimens for study, research, and display. These tools allow for precise cutting to reveal the internal structures of specimens. Custom Lapidary Work: Lapidary artists and enthusiasts use slab Saws to create custom-designed slabs for use in their lapidary projects. These slabs can be used for cabochon cutting , carving, and jewelry making. Jewelry Material Production: Slab Saws are employed to cut lapidary materials into thin, flat pieces suitable for use in jewelry making. These slabs can be used for cabochons, inlay work, and other jewelry applications. Tumbling Material Preparation: Lapidary enthusiasts and rock collectors use slab Saws to cut rough rocks and minerals into smaller, more uniform pieces suitable for tumbling. This process produces polished stones for use in various decorative and artistic applications. Education and Workshops: Lapidary slab Saws are used in lapidary workshops, geology labs, and educational settings to teach cutting and slabbing techniques to students and hobbyists. Artistic and Decorative Work: Artists and craftsmen use slab Saws to create decorative pieces and artistic installations featuring natural stone slabs. These slabs can be incorporated into sculptures, architectural elements, and other creative projects. Mineral Dealers and Collectors: Those involved in the trade of minerals and gemstones use slab Saws to cut specimens for sale, display, and trade. This allows collectors and dealers to showcase the interior beauty of specimens.
